2. Understanding the Wi-Fi Hotspot: The Secret Weapon
At its core, a Wi-Fi hotspot is simply your laptop acting as a mini-router. It takes the internet connection it receives (either through a wired connection, another Wi-Fi network, or even a mobile data connection) and rebroadcasts it as a new Wi-Fi signal. Think of it like this: Your laptop is a relay runner, passing the digital baton (internet signal) to other devices.

4. Unleashing the Power: How to Turn Your Laptop into a Long-Range Hotspot
The beauty of this is how easy it is. Here's a general guide, with slight variations depending on your operating system:
- Windows: Go to Settings > Network & Internet > Mobile Hotspot. Toggle the "Share my Internet connection with other devices" switch to "On." You can customize the network name (SSID) and password.
- macOS: Go to System Preferences > Sharing. Check the "Internet Sharing" box. Choose your internet source from the "Share your connection from" dropdown. Then, under "To computers using," select "Wi-Fi." Click "Wi-Fi Options" to set the network name and password.
Follow these steps, and voila! You're a Wi-Fi superhero.

Understanding the WiFi Landscape: Power, Protocols, and Propagation
Before we delve into the methods of amplifying your laptop's WiFi hotspot capabilities, it's crucial to grasp the fundamentals. WiFi signals, governed by the Institute of Electrical and Electronics Engineers (IEEE) 802.11 standards, transmit information via radio waves. The strength of these waves, measured in decibels relative to a milliwatt (dBm), directly impacts the range and reliability of your connection. A lower dBm value indicates a stronger signal.
The 802.11 protocol used is also essential. Older protocols like 802.11b offer shorter ranges and slower speeds compared to newer standards like 802.11ac and 802.11ax (WiFi 6). These newer protocols leverage advanced technologies like Multiple Input, Multiple Output (MIMO) and beamforming to increase both range and throughput. The physical environment plays a monumental role. Obstacles like walls, trees, and even atmospheric conditions can significantly attenuate a WiFi signal.
Maximizing Your Laptop's WiFi: Software Tweaks and Configuration
The first step towards boosting your laptop's WiFi hotspot effectiveness lies in optimal configuration. Most operating systems, Windows, macOS, and Linux, offer built-in hotspot functionalities. However, the default settings aren’t always optimized for range.
Channel Selection: WiFi routers operate on specific channels, just like radio stations. The 2.4 GHz band offers more channels but can experience interference from other devices. The 5 GHz band offers fewer channels but faster speeds and less congestion. Experimenting with different channels within your router's and hotspot's settings can sometimes improve signal strength. Employing a WiFi analyzer app on your smartphone or another device can provide data on network traffic.
Security Protocols: WPA2 and WPA3 are the most secure WiFi security protocols. Avoid using WEP, as it is easily cracked. Strong encryption not only protects your data but can also improve the overall connection stability.
Power Management: Ensure that your laptop's power settings are optimized for performance. In Windows, navigate to Power Options and adjust your power plan to "High Performance" when creating a hotspot. Similarly, in macOS, disable Energy Saver settings that limit WiFi performance.
Hardware Arsenal: Amplifying Your Signal with External Antennas and Adapters
Software tweaks offer incremental improvements. To truly unleash insane long-range power, you'll need to augment your laptop's internal WiFi hardware. The most efficient method involves employing external antennas and powerful WiFi adapters.
High-Gain Antennas: The antenna is the most substantial determiner of range. High-gain antennas focus WiFi signals in a specific direction, increasing signal strength in that direction. Directional antennas like Yagi-Uda or parabolic antennas are extraordinarily effective for extending range. For omnidirectional coverage, consider a high-gain dipole or rubber duck antenna.
USB WiFi Adapters: External USB WiFi adapters are a cost-effective method to upgrade your laptop's WiFi capabilities. Choose an adapter that supports the latest 802.11 standards (ac or ax) and possesses multiple antennas for MIMO technology which is superior to single-antenna adapters. Some adapters also offer significantly more power output than built-in WiFi cards, further extending range. When selecting, pay close attention to the transmit power (measured in dBm). Higher transmit power equates to a more powerful signal.
Antenna Placement and Orientation: The correct placement and orientation of your external equipment is key. For directional antennas, accurately pointing the antenna towards the desired coverage area is fundamental. Consider the angle of elevation and azimuth. Mounting the antenna higher, away from obstructions, will always enhance range.
The Art of the External Amplifier: Fine-Tuning Your Setup
The most significant step towards long-range WiFi performance is the use of external amplifiers. External amplifiers take the signal from your laptop or WiFi adapter, amplify it, and transmit it through a separate antenna.
WiFi Amplifiers: WiFi amplifiers are inserted between the WiFi adapter and the antenna. They typically boost the signal in both directions; they amplify the signal heading to your external devices while also augmenting the signal coming back from these devices.
Understanding the Amplifier Specifications: When selecting an amplifier, carefully review its specifications. Pay attention to the gain (measured in decibels, dB), which indicates the degree of signal amplification. Select an amplifier that is compatible with your WiFi adapter and antenna. Look for a low noise figure (NF), which indicates how much the amplifier adds noise to the signal.
Weatherproofing: If you plan to use your long-range WiFi hotspot outdoors, it's essential to weatherproof your equipment. Enclose the adapter, amplifier, and any connections in a weather-resistant enclosure. Choose outdoor-rated antennas designed to withstand the elements.
Advanced Configurations for Extreme Range: Repeaters and Mesh Networks
For applications requiring truly insane range, consider techniques beyond using a single laptop and enhanced configuration.
WiFi Repeaters: A WiFi repeater essentially rebroadcasts your WiFi signal, extending its reach. Position a repeater in a location within range of your original hotspot and in a good location for getting connectivity. Repeaters can effectively bypass distance. However, repeaters reduce the available bandwidth.
Mesh Networks: More sophisticated than simple repeaters, a mesh network uses multiple nodes that communicate with each other to create a unified WiFi network. A node communicates with other nodes to deliver wider range coverage, unlike a simple repeater. Mesh systems offer excellent coverage with minimal loss in bandwidth.
Point-to-Point Backhauls: For the most extreme range, consider employing a point-to-point link utilizing directional antennas and dedicated radio hardware. This method involves transmitting a WiFi signal across substantial distances. These point-to-point links demand precise alignment and often require professional installation.
